What Is SMS Dash Receive?
SMS Dash Receive is a new service that enables users to send and receive Dash remittance payments using text messaging on mobile phones, making the service accessible and user-friendly regardless of bank accounts or access to traditional banking services.
How Does SMS Dash Receive Work?
To use SMS Dash Receive, users simply send a text message with the amount and recipient phone number to an assigned number, along with an amount they wish to transfer. They will then receive instructions on how they can claim their funds.
SMS Dash Receive is powered by the Dash blockchain, providing faster transaction times and lower fees than traditional banking systems – making it the perfect solution for individuals who need to send and receive money quickly and affordably.

What are the potential drawbacks of SMS Dash Receive?
As with any new technology, the SMS Dash Receive service does have some drawbacks. One main downside of cryptocurrency payments for remittance payments is their potential volatility; because cryptocurrency values fluctuate quickly, there’s always the chance that its value could decrease before its recipient can claim it.
Another potential drawback of using the SMS Dash Receive service is fraud risk. Since it relies heavily on text messaging, scammers could potentially intercept these texts and steal funds from users.
